In the mArs art space (3, Champ de Mars), from Tuesday, December 20, the Winter Days exposition is open to everyone. The exhibition is part of the New Wanderers project and will be available until January 8.
According to the tradition already established in the mArs art space, the last exhibition of the year is not just a personal exhibition of one artist, but also an event that brings together many significant St. Petersburg authors and gives the viewer a sense of joy from the approaching holidays. The dominant motif of the exhibition was the winter landscape, including the urban one. Visitors to the art space can mentally wander both through the snow-covered expanses of forests and through the narrow streets of St. Petersburg, already covered by the pre-New Year hype, look into the windows in which Christmas candles flicker and, of course, admire the Christmas tree under which sits a bunny – a symbol of the new, 2023 th year.

The collective exhibition gives the opportunity to see many points of view on art, to discover new names and artistic techniques. The exposition contains both graphics and oil and acrylic paintings, and even textiles! The sizes of the works also vary – from small, chamber landscapes to large-scale painted screens. The time frames of the presented works are also wide: many artists provided works that have already been tested by time, and some works were created specifically for the art space.

The exhibition was attended by: Andrey Selenin, Anatoly Alekseev, Tatyana Vlasova, Aron Zinstein, Gafur Mendagaliev, Irina Dudina, Alexander Gushchin, Nikolai Gavrilenko, Elena Shchelchkova, Elena Bocharova, Alexander Kondratiev, Vera Fedorova and Svetlana Zelenaya.
Entrance to the exposition is free.
